云服务器上的web项目获取不到css

发布时间:2023-09-18 点击:129
在进行web项目开发时,使用云服务器作为主机环境已经成为主流趋势,而在这个过程中,遇到了web项目无法获取css的情况也是很常见的问题。本篇文章将分析并解决云服务器上的web项目获取不到css的情况。
一、什么是css?
css即层叠样式表,用于描述文档(html文档、xhtml文档或xml文档等)的渲染外观。css常常用来设计web页面、显示不同的字体、颜色、大小、布局等。
二、为什么会出现获取不到css的情况?
2.1 服务器路径不一致导致的问题
在开发过程中,我们经常会遇到html文件引入css文件时路径错误的情况。而在云服务器上,尤其是在多个域名或网站共享一个服务器的情况下,路径不一致就更容易出现。如果服务器上的路径不一致,就会导致css文件无法加载,进而出现获取不到css的问题。
2.2 域名访问问题
当在本地开发环境中运行web项目时,我们可以通过localhost或者127.0.0.1来访问,但是在云服务器上,通常会使用ip地址或者域名来进行访问。如果域名访问出现了问题,也会导致无法获取css文件。
2.3 网络堵塞问题
在使用云服务器时,我们需要通过互联网进行访问。而在一些网络繁忙的情况下,互联网传输数据的速度就会变慢,这也可能会导致无法获取css文件的问题。
三、解决方案
3.1 确认路径是否正确
在项目开发中,我们通常会使用相对路径来引用css文件。记得在云服务器上的web项目中,路径可能不同,要注意路径的正确性。如果路径错误,就无法正常加载css文件。
3.2 确认域名解析是否正确
在使用云服务器时,我们需要确认域名解析是否正确。如果解析不正确,就会导致无法访问云服务器,进而导致无法获取css文件。可以使用nslookup或者ping命令来检测域名是否可用。
3.3 安装cdn加速
在使用云服务器时,我们可以考虑安装cdn加速来提高访问速度。通过cdn加速,可以确定文件能够更快地从服务器传递到客户端。这可以解决由于网络繁忙或传输速度过慢而无法获取css文件的问题。
四、技巧和建议
4.1 开启浏览器的开发者工具调试
当遇到无法获取css文件的问题时,我们可以使用浏览器的开发者工具进行调试。可以查看请求和响应,以便确定问题所在。
4.2 指定绝对路径
为了避免路径错误,在云服务器上,我们推荐使用绝对路径而不是相对路径。这可以确保正确地加载css文件,防止路径不一致的问题。
4.3 更新浏览器缓存
如果问题一段时间内一直存在,可以尝试清除浏览器缓存。缓存不仅可以加速页面加载速度,还可以影响文件加载。因此,可以通过清除浏览器缓存来解决获取不到css文件的问题。
五、总结
在云服务器上进行web项目开发是非常常见的情况。当出现无法获取css文件的问题时,我们应该注意路径是否一致、域名是否解析正确和网络是否拥堵。此外,我们还可以尝试使用开发者工具、cdn加速和更新缓存等方法来解决问题。
以上就是小编关于“云服务器上的web项目获取不到css”的分享和介绍


2019年阿里购买云服务器优惠
如何防止权重传递
网页内容四川 旅游信息化与应用促进会和四川 川联民营企业
云服务器ecs独立ip吗
网站都打不开-云服务器问题
新加坡ecs云服务器禁止启动
seo常用优化技巧有哪些?seo怎么布局关键词?
母婴食用品店不亏反赚全靠这套全网营销方案